Lines Matching defs:usb_composite_dev
462 struct usb_composite_dev { struct
463 struct usb_gadget *gadget;
464 struct usb_request *req;
465 struct usb_request *os_desc_req;
467 struct usb_configuration *config;
470 u8 qw_sign[OS_STRING_QW_SIGN_LEN];
471 u8 b_vendor_code;
472 struct usb_configuration *os_desc_config;
473 unsigned int use_os_string:1;
476 u16 bcd_webusb_version;
477 u8 b_webusb_vendor_code;
478 char landing_page[WEBUSB_URL_RAW_MAX_LENGTH];
479 unsigned int use_webusb:1;
483 unsigned int suspended:1;
484 struct usb_device_descriptor desc;
485 struct list_head configs;
486 struct list_head gstrings;
510 extern int usb_string_id(struct usb_composite_dev *c); argument